15601010555066 has 8 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 24418973042784. Its totient is φ = 7461352874140.
The previous prime is 15601010555057. The next prime is 15601010555087. The reversal of 15601010555066 is 66055501010651.
It is a sphenic number, since it is the product of 3 distinct primes.
It is a Curzon number.
It is an unprimeable number.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 3 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 169576201640 + ... + 169576201731.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(3052371630348).
Almost surely, 215601010555066 is an apocalyptic number.
15601010555066 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(8817962487718).
15601010555066 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
15601010555066 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 339152403396.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 135000, while the sum is 41.
